A MAN has been arrested following the alleged rape of a woman behind a retail park in Leigh.

Earlier this morning, residents reported witnessing a police presence along Parsonage Way, behind Parsonage retail park.

A blue police tent was also seen in the bushes near to Westleigh Brook, intended to preserve the scene.

Greater Manchester Police has confirmed that the incident is in connection with an alleged rape in the early hours, with a man in his 40s arrested.

A spokesperson for Greater Manchester Police said: "Officers were called to a report of the concern for welfare of a woman on Parsonage Way in Manchester just after 6.10am this morning (Wednesday, May 22).

"From initial enquiries, detectives believe that the woman was raped and a man in his 40s was arrested on suspicion of rape at the scene. He remains in police custody for questioning. 

"An investigation was immediately launched and a number of lines of enquiry are already being followed up. The victim is also currently being supported by specialist services."
